Saw palmetto is a palm-like fruit obtained from the shrub ‘Serenoa Repens.’ The primary use of the ingredient has long been limited to the treatment of Benign Prostatic Hypertrophy or BPH, especially in men. Now, research has been going on to prove its efficacy in curing acne and hair loss. Read on to know more. (1)
Saw Palmetto for Acne
Acne deemed the most bothersome skin problem, lacks effective root cures among various skincare products and treatments, often leading to unforeseen side effects. Consequently, many individuals turn to natural remedies for acne, with saw palmetto emerging as a noteworthy solution.
(a) What Causes Acne?
Now, before we peep into the effectiveness of saw palmetto in curing acne, let’s take a look at the causes behind developing pesky breakouts like this:
- The main evil behind adolescent acne is nothing but frequent hormonal changes. Those years of life are usually characterized by significant hormonal imbalances experienced by our body, which our skin reflects as acne.
- The testosterone hormone present in our body mainly causes adult acne. It is an inflammation of the sebaceous glands lying under the skin surface, which happens in response to the over-secretion of testosterone.

(b) Why to Use Saw Palmetto?
Saw palmetto is believed to be one of the highly effective natural remedies for acne. Though there is not much scientific research to prove the truthfulness of this claim, people who have already tried this ingredient for this purpose are pretty happy with the results. Let us try to figure out how it is related to the removal of acne:
- The saw palmetto extract is rich in polysaccharides, positively affecting our immune system. Experts say polysaccharides significantly boost our immunity and possess powerful anti-inflammatory qualities. Both of these are essential to prevent inflammatory skin issues like acne breakouts.
- Saw palmetto plays a vital role in slowing testosterone’s transformation process, thereby preventing dihydrotestosterone (DHT) formation. It may increase the level of testosterone hormone in our body at an alarming rate and cause severe acne. But, saw palmetto can act as an anti-androgenic amalgam and shrink the levels of androgen hormones considerably inside our body. As a result, the outbreaks driven by hormones are reduced to a great extent.
- Just like averting the inflammation of sebaceous glands and hair follicles resting under the surface layer of our skin, saw palmetto can also open up clogged skin pores. It reduces the chances of inflammation as well as keeps acne at bay.

Hair loss results from several factors. While some cause acute hair thinning, others may lead to complete baldness. Let us take a quick look at the reasons for hair loss first:
- Testosterone is one of the biggest causes of baldness in men. As the level of this hormone rises dramatically in the body after puberty, men start experiencing hair fall in large amounts.
- Like testosterone, the female hormone estrogen is also responsible for hair thinning in women. When estrogen levels decrease in the female body, hair falls unnaturally.
- Besides, nutritional deficiency, stress, psychological changes, etc., can also result in loss of hair to a considerable extent.
(b) Why to Use Saw Palmetto?
Using the extract of saw palmetto can be very beneficial for our hair, and it can stop hair loss in the following ways:
- As said before, it can control the testosterone hormone level, which averts baldness in men eventually.
- It is enriched with plant sterols and several fatty acids, which our hair strands require to thrive. Consequently, our hair becomes more robust, and we experience less hair fall.
However, you must regularly consult your doctor before taking saw palmetto to cure acne and hair loss.
